Auto Draft

October 2020 Off By admin

Extract Data From Any Website With 1 Click With Data Miner

It allows you to scape multiple pages and offers dynamic information extraction capabilities. 80legs is a powerful but flexible net crawling software that may be configured to your needs.
Websites that present lists of knowledge typically do it by querying a database and displaying the info in a person pleasant manner. A net scraper reverses this course of by taking unstructured websites and turning them back into an organized database. This knowledge can then be exported to a database or a spreadsheet file, similar to CSV or Excel. One of the most intestering features is that they provide constructed-in knowledge flows. Meaning not only you can scrape knowledge from external websites, but you can also remodel the data, use external APIs (like Clearbit, Google Sheets…).
#cbdlife can in-flip make use of internet scraping APIs which helps him/her develop the software program simply. For example allows you to easily get APIs to scrape knowledge from any website. A web scraping software will mechanically load and extract information from a number of pages of websites primarily based in your requirement. It is both custom built for a selected website or is one which may be configured to work with any web site. With the click of a button you’ll be able to easily save the data obtainable within the web site to a file in your computer.

Developing in-home web scrapers is painful as a result of web sites are constantly altering. You need ten totally different rules (XPath, CSS selectors…) to handle the completely different instances. Web Scraper runs in your browser and would not anything require to be installed in your computer.
A Web Scraper is a program that quite actually scrapes or gathers knowledge off of websites. Take the beneath hypothetical example, where we would build an online scraper that might go to twitter, and gather the content material of tweets. A net scraper is a specialised software designed to accurately and shortly extract knowledge from an online page. Web scrapers differ broadly in design and complexity, relying on the project.
Website Scraper
Wrapper generation algorithms assume that enter pages of a wrapper induction system conform to a common template and that they can be simply recognized in terms of a URL widespread scheme. Moreover, some semi-structured data question languages, such as XQuery and the HTQL, can be used to parse HTML pages and to retrieve and rework page content.
You needn’t pay the expense of costly web scraping or doing handbook analysis. The tool will allow you to exact structured data from any URL with AI extractors. Do share your story with us utilizing the comments part below. Web scraping instruments may help keep you abreast on the place your company or business is heading within the subsequent six months, serving as a robust software for market research. The instruments can fetchd ata from multiple information analytics suppliers and market analysis firms, and consolidating them into one spot for easy reference and evaluation.

Secondly, a web scraper would wish to know which tags to search for the data we need to scrape. In the above example, we will see that we might have plenty of information we wouldn’t need to scrape, such because the header, the emblem, navigation hyperlinks, and so forth. Most of the particular tweets would in all probability be in a paragraph tag, or have a particular class or different identifying feature.

This advanced web scraper permits extracting knowledge is as simple as clicking the info you need. It allows you to obtain your scraped knowledge in any format for evaluation. Web scraping tools are specially developed software program for extracting helpful info from the websites.
The pages being scraped might embrace metadata or semantic markups and annotations, which can be used to find particular data snippets. If the annotations are embedded in the pages, as Microformat does, this system can be viewed as a special case of DOM parsing. Many web sites have large collections of pages generated dynamically from an underlying structured source like a database. Data of the identical category are typically encoded into comparable pages by a common script or template. In data mining, a program that detects such templates in a specific data supply, extracts its content and interprets it right into a relational type, is known as a wrapper.

Although internet scraping can be accomplished manually, typically, automated tools are preferred when scraping net information as they are often more cost effective and work at a quicker price. With so many choices for connecting on-line companies, IFTTT, or considered one of its options is the perfect tool for easy knowledge assortment by scraping web sites.
For this instance, we’ll focus on using Python, and it’s accompanying library, Beautiful Soup. It’s additionally necessary to notice right here, that in order to construct a profitable net scraper, we’ll have to be a minimum of considerably acquainted with HTML constructions, and knowledge codecs like JSON. In the above example, we might use an internet scraper to gather data from Twitter.
In this publish, we’re itemizing the use cases of web scraping tools and the highest 10 internet scraping tools to collect info, with zero coding. Web Scraping instruments are particularly developed for extracting information from web sites. They are also known as net harvesting tools 30 Best Free Lead Generation Software to Get Clients in 2020 or internet data extraction instruments. These instruments are helpful for anyone trying to collect some type of information from the Internet. Web Scraping is the brand new knowledge entry approach that don’t require repetitive typing or copy-pasting.

Step 1: Create A New Php File Called Scraper Php And Include The Library Mentioned Below:

As proven within the video above, WebHarvy is some extent and click on internet scraper which helps you to scrape knowledge from websites with ease. Unlike most other internet scraper software program, WebHarvy could be configured to extract the required knowledge from web sites with mouse clicks. You just need to select the information to be extracted by pointing the mouse. We advocate that you attempt the analysis model of WebHarvy or see the video demo. You can hire a developer to build custom knowledge extraction software program on your specific requirement.

Webscraper Io

Knowing tips on how to establish the place the data on the web page is takes a little research earlier than we build the scraper. Scrapy is a fast excessive-degree net crawling and internet scraping framework, used to crawl websites and extract structured data from their pages.
In distinction, if you attempt to get the information you want manually, you would possibly spend plenty of time clicking, scrolling, and looking out. This is very true should you want massive amounts of data from web sites which might be often up to date with new content material. The incredible quantity of knowledge on the Internet is a wealthy useful resource for any field of research or private interest.
The net scraper provides 20 scraping hours free of charge and can cost $29 per 30 days. Using a web scraping tool, one also can download options for offline studying or storage by collecting data from multiple sites (including StackOverflow and more Q&A web sites). This reduces dependence on lively Internet connections as the resources are readily available regardless of the supply of Internet entry. These software search for new information manually or mechanically, fetching the new or up to date knowledge and storing them in your easy access. For instance, one may gather info about products and their prices from Amazon utilizing a scraping software.
Website Scraper
Mozenda permits you to extract text, photographs and PDF content from web pages. It lets you manage and put together information recordsdata for publishing. FMiner is one other popular device for web scraping, information extraction, crawling screen scraping, macro, and web help for Window and Mac OS. Diffbot allows you to get numerous sort of helpful data from the net without the hassle.
  • Web scraping an internet web page includes fetching it and extracting from it.
  • The content material of a page could also be parsed, searched, reformatted, its knowledge copied into a spreadsheet, and so on.
  • Therefore, net crawling is a main component of net scraping, to fetch pages for later processing.
  • Some net scraping software may also be used to extract data from an API immediately.
  • There are many software program instruments obtainable that can be utilized to customise web-scraping solutions.

It helps fetching large amounts of data together with the option to download the extracted knowledge immediately. The internet scraper claims to crawl 600,000+ domains and is utilized by massive players like MailChimp and PayPal. CloudScrape also supports nameless knowledge entry by providing a set of proxy servers to cover your identity. CloudScrape shops your knowledge on its servers for two weeks before archiving it.
Firstly, the information that you just access on the Internet just isn’t available for download. So you need a way to obtain the information from multiple pages of a web site or from multiple web sites. While you have been inspecting the web page, you found that the link is a part of the component that has the title HTML class.
To effectively harvest that data, you’ll have to turn into skilled at web scraping. The Python libraries requests and Beautiful Soup are powerful tools for the job. If you prefer to be taught with palms-on examples and you’ve got a fundamental understanding of Python and HTML, then this tutorial is for you. This also permits for very simple integration of superior features such as IP rotation, which can forestall your scraper from getting blocked from main web sites as a result of their scraping exercise. However, the instruments out there to construct your personal web scraper nonetheless require some superior programming data.
We might limit the gathered information to tweets a few specific topic, or by a specific creator. As you may think, the information that we gather from an internet Web Scraping, Data Extraction and Automation scraper would largely be decided by the parameters we give the program once we construct it. At the bare minimum, every web scraping project would want to have a URL to scrape from.
QVC’s complaint alleges that the defendant disguised its net crawler to mask its supply IP handle and thus prevented QVC from quickly repairing the problem. This is a very interesting scraping case as a result of QVC is looking for damages for the unavailability of their website, which QVC claims was brought on by Resultly.
It’s the perfect device for non-technical folks seeking to extract knowledge, whether or not that is for a small one-off project, or an enterprise kind scrape operating each hour. First, which can be domestically installed in your pc and second, which runs in cloud – browser based mostly. The primary concept of internet scraping is that we are taking current HTML knowledge, using an online scraper to determine the info, and convert it into a useful format. The end stage is to have this information saved as both JSON, or in another helpful format. As you can see from the diagram, we may use any technology we’d prefer to build the precise net scraper, similar to Python, PHP and even Node, simply to call a couple of.
Build scrapers, scrape websites and export data in CSV format instantly out of your browser. Use Web Scraper Cloud to export knowledge in CSV, XLSX and JSON codecs, access it through API, webhooks or get it exported by way of Dropbox. ParseHub has been a reliable and consistent internet scraper for us for almost two years now. Setting up your tasks has a bit of a learning curve, however that is a small funding for how powerful their service is.
These tools are useful for anyone who is trying to collect some form of knowledge from the Internet. The open web is by far the best world repository for human information, there may be nearly no information that you can’t find by way of extracting net data. With our superior internet scraper, extracting data is as easy as clicking on the data you need.
Some web sites don’t prefer it when computerized scrapers collect their knowledge, while others don’t mind. The first step towards scraping the net with R requires you to understand HTML and net scraping fundamentals. You’ll learn how to get browsers to show the supply code, then you’ll develop the logic of markup languages which units you on the path to scrape that data. And, above all – you’ll master the vocabulary you have to scrape data with R. Web scraper is a chrome extension which helps you for the online scraping and information acquisition.
It can be utilized for a wide range of functions, from knowledge mining to monitoring and automatic testing. Bots can generally be blocked with tools to verify that it is a real individual accessing the positioning, like a CAPTCHA. Bots are typically coded to explicitly break particular CAPTCHA patterns or might make use of third-get together companies that utilize human labor to learn and respond in real-time to CAPTCHA challenges.

Need Help In Web Scraping?

There are many software program instruments out there that can be used to customise net-scraping solutions. Some net scraping software can also be used to extract knowledge from an API immediately. Web scraping an online page involves fetching it and extracting from it.
Therefore, web crawling is a main part of internet scraping, to fetch pages for later processing. The content material of a page may be parsed, searched, reformatted, its data copied right into a spreadsheet, and so on. Web scrapers sometimes take one thing out of a web page, to utilize it for an additional purpose some place else. An instance could be to seek out and copy names and phone numbers, or corporations and their URLs, to an inventory . Web scraping, net harvesting, or net knowledge extraction is information scraping used for extracting information from websites.
On the other hand, with a dynamic web site the server may not ship again any HTML at all. This will look fully completely different from what you noticed whenever you inspected the page with your browser’s developer tools.

Web scraping is the method of gathering information from the Internet. Even copy-pasting the lyrics of your favorite song is a type of web scraping! However, the phrases “web scraping” normally refer to a process that entails automation.

What Prerequisites Do We Need To Build A Web Scraper?

The easiest type of internet scraping is manually copying and pasting information from a web web page right into a textual content file or spreadsheet. Web pages are built utilizing text-based mark-up languages , and frequently contain a wealth of helpful knowledge in text kind. However, most net pages are designed for human finish-users and never for ease of automated use. As a outcome, specialised tools and software program have been developed to facilitate the scraping of web pages. Why net scraping has become so important is because of a set of factors.
Web Scraper utilizes a modular construction that is made of selectors, which instructs the scraper on how to traverse the goal web site and what data to extract. Thanks to this construction, Web Scraper is ready to extract info from modern and dynamic websites similar to Amazon, Tripadvisor, eBay, and so forth, as well as from smaller, lesser-identified web sites.

Website Scraper
There are tons of HTML components here and there, hundreds of attributes scattered round—and wasn’t there some JavaScript combined in as well? It’s time to parse this prolonged code response with Beautiful Soup to make it more accessible and pick out the info that you simply’re thinking about.
Author Bio

About the Author: Hailee is a blogger at wellnessandreleaf, clinchriverhempcompany and







Telephone:(805) 625-9420 —

Address: 32932 Pacific Coast Highway, Number 14204, Dana Point, California, 92629Dana Point, California

Published Articles:

Previous work

As Featured in scraping software program could access the World Wide Web instantly using the Hypertext Transfer Protocol, or through an internet browser. While web scraping may be done manually by a software consumer, the time period usually refers to automated processes applied using a bot or web crawler. It is a form of copying, in which specific knowledge is gathered and copied from the net, sometimes into a central native database or spreadsheet, for later retrieval or analysis. First, our group of seasoned scraping veterans develops a scraper unique to your project, designed specifically to target and extract the data you need from the web sites you need it from.
The scope of this information additionally increases with the number of options you’d like your scraper to have. Then the scraper will both extract all the info on the web page or specific data chosen by the person earlier than the project is run. First, the net scraper might be given one or more URLs to load before scraping. The scraper then hundreds the whole HTML code for the page in query. More superior scrapers will render the whole web site, including CSS and Javascript elements.

Essential Http, Html & Css For Web Scrapers

The present code strips away the whole hyperlink when accessing the .textual content attribute of its father or mother component. As you’ve seen before, .textual content solely accommodates the visible textual content content material of an HTML factor. To get the precise URL, you want to extract one of those attributes as an alternative of discarding it. You’ve successfully scraped some HTML from the Internet, however if you take a look at it now, it simply seems like a huge mess.

Website Scraper